Rich Artistic Connotation & Historical Background:
In traditional Chinese Beijing Opera, the princess headdress and phoenix crown are important elements in the costumes of female characters.
They represent an elegant, delicate, and gorgeous style, showcasing the unique charm of ancient Chinese culture.
These headdresses and hair accessories are usually made of silk, adorned with exquisite embroidery and jewelry such as pearls, gems, and gold threads.
They not only have aesthetic value but also carry rich historical significance and cultural connotations.
In Beijing Opera, princess headdresses are often used to portray royal members or aristocratic women.
The design inspiration for these headdresses comes from ancient Chinese court costumes, including dragon robes, phoenix crowns, and various accessories.
They are usually crafted using complex techniques that require exquisite skills and patience.
Each headdress has its unique design and characteristics, reflecting the historical background and aesthetic concepts of different periods and regions.
The phoenix crown is one of the most representative female headdresses in Beijing Opera.
It consists of two parts: the metal frame on the head and neck, and the feather decoration on top.
The design inspiration for the phoenix crown comes from the mythical creature of the same name, symbolizing auspiciousness, happiness, and power.
Its shape is usually round or oval, with a long feather decoration on top that can be spread out or folded up.
The color of the phoenix crown is usually gold or red, echoing traditional royal attire.
In addition to princess headdresses and phoenix crowns, there are other important female character costumes in Beijing Opera, such as python robes, flower dan clothing, and martial art clothing.
These costumes all have unique designs and styles, reflecting the diversity and richness of ancient Chinese culture.
